Amarin (AMRN) IP Chief to Depart Company as AMR101 Exclusivity Still in Air

Amarin Corporation plc (Nasdaq: AMRN) shares are trading lower Friday morning following reports of a management shakeup.
According to Bloomberg, Jonathon Rowe, head of Amarin's Intellectual Property and Portfolio Strategy will be departing the company to join another pharma firm.
His announcement will most likely come next week. The exec said Amarin has hired a patent attorney who previously worked at Sanofi-Aventis (NYSE: SNY).
Investors might be a little uneasy as market exclusivity for AMR101 still remains uncertain. In an August 29th note, Monness, Crespi, Hardt said it "remains unclear whether or not Amarin will be able to establish sufficiently long market exclusivity for the drug."
Amarin's applications with the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office for AMR101 for method-of-use patents have recently been rejected two further times, possibly promptin Rowe's departure.
Shares of Amarin are down 2 percent on Friday's session.
